Questions & Answers about Η ευζωία είναι σημαντική.

How do I pronounce Η ευζωία είναι σημαντική?

A good approximate pronunciation is:

  • Ηee
  • ευζωίαev-zo-EE-a
  • είναιEE-ne
  • σημαντικήsee-man-dee-KEE

So the whole sentence is roughly:

ee ev-zo-EE-a EE-ne see-man-dee-KEE

A useful detail: ευ can sound like ev or ef. Here it is ev because the next sound, ζ, is voiced.

Why is there a η before ευζωία?

Because η is the feminine singular definite article, meaning the.

Greek often uses the definite article with abstract nouns much more naturally than English does. So where English might say just well-being is important, Greek commonly says the well-being is important in form, even though the natural English translation usually drops the.

Here η also tells you that ευζωία is:

  • feminine
  • singular
  • nominative
What gender, number, and case is ευζωία?

ευζωία is:

  • feminine
  • singular
  • nominative

It is nominative because it is the subject of the sentence: Η ευζωία είναι σημαντική = Well-being is important.

The ending -ία is very often found in feminine nouns, so that is a helpful pattern to notice.

Why does σημαντική end in ? Why not some other form?

Because adjectives in Greek agree with the noun they describe in:

  • gender
  • number
  • case

Since ευζωία is feminine singular nominative, the adjective must also be feminine singular nominative:

  • masculine: σημαντικός
  • feminine: σημαντική
  • neuter: σημαντικό

So σημαντική is the correct form to match η ευζωία.

What form is είναι here?

είναι is the present-tense form of είμαι, meaning to be.

In this sentence it means is.

A useful thing to know: in Modern Greek, είναι is used for both:

  • he/she/it is
  • they are

So Greek does not change this form based on gender, and this particular form is also the same in singular and plural third person.

Is the word order fixed? Could I move the words around?

The neutral, straightforward order is:

Η ευζωία είναι σημαντική.

Greek word order is more flexible than English, so you can move things for emphasis. For example:

  • Σημαντική είναι η ευζωία.

This still means essentially the same thing, but it emphasizes σημαντική.

However, changing the structure can also change the meaning. For example:

  • η σημαντική ευζωία

does not mean the same thing as the full sentence. That means the important well-being, which is a noun phrase, not a complete sentence.

What do the accent marks mean in these words?

The accent mark shows which syllable is stressed.

In this sentence:

  • ευζωία → stress on -ί-
  • είναι → stress on the first syllable
  • σημαντική → stress on the last syllable

Stress matters in Greek pronunciation, so the written accent is important and should be learned as part of the word.

Can I leave out η or είναι?

Normally, no.

In standard everyday Greek, you would usually keep both:

  • η because the noun naturally takes the article here
  • είναι because it is the verb is

So the normal full sentence is:

Η ευζωία είναι σημαντική.

You might see omissions in headlines, notes, or poetic language, but that is not the standard form a learner should start with.

Is ευζωία a common everyday word?

It is a real and useful word, but it can sound a bit formal or abstract depending on context.

You will often meet it in set phrases and more formal discussion, especially in contexts like welfare or quality of life, for example:

  • η ευζωία των ζώων = animal welfare

So it is definitely worth learning, but depending on context, everyday Greek might sometimes use other expressions too.
